I'm wondering whether anyone has added a separate air data computer and what the issues are in interfacing with an IFD. By separate, I mean not an Aspen or G500 but a discrete unit such as those available from Sandia, Shadin, etc.

Originally posted by Roger Roger wrote:

That would be great to have accurate speed and altitude tape on the IFD100.  How does one go about getting that data on there?

You just need to have a ADC coupled to your IFD550 and the tapes will be there on the IFD100. Something about the FAA is why they don't display them natively on the IFD550 itself.

The bugs I mentioned, at least in my configuration, only impact the heading and generate orphan error messages.  The tapes remain and seem accurate.
